1. Visit the Ancient Ruins of Apollo’s Temple in Didim

Step back in time and visit the ancient ruins of Apollo’s Temple in Didim. This historical site dates back to the 4th century BC and was dedicated to the god Apollo. As you explore, you will see stunning columns and intricate carvings that have endured the test of time.

Wander through the remains of the temple and imagine it bustling with ancient worshippers. The temple was once an important religious site and part of the larger ancient city of Didyma. A guided tour can enhance your understanding of its significance and history.

Not far from the temple, there’s a serene landscape that complements the ancient ruins. Take a moment to enjoy the peaceful atmosphere and stunning views. The site is a perfect spot for photography, capturing the blend of history and nature.

The proximity to modern Didim adds to the charm, offering local cafes where you can relax after your visit. Enjoy a snack or drink while reflecting on the grandeur of Apollo’s Temple.

This ancient site is a must-visit for history enthusiasts and anyone seeking to revel in the rich heritage of the area.

10. Take a Guided Tour to the Nearby Historic Village of Miletus

Take a guided tour to the nearby historic village of Miletus, known for its ancient theater and impressive archaeological sites. Just a short distance from Didim, this ancient city has a rich history dating back thousands of years.

Explore the well-preserved ruins, including the famous theater that could seat thousands of spectators. The architecture and layout of the city offer insights into ancient Greek and Roman life. As you stroll through the ancient streets, imagine the people who once walked there.

A knowledgeable guide will share captivating stories and details about the site that enhance your understanding. They can answer your questions and provide context to what you’re seeing.

Don’t forget your camera, as the stunning backdrops make for fantastic photographs. The picturesque surroundings and historical significance combine to create memorable experiences.

Visiting Miletus is a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in history, ensuring your trip to Didim is both enriching and fun.

20. Take a Day Trip to the Nearby Greek Island of Kos for an Exciting Cultural Experience

Take a day trip to the nearby Greek island of Kos for an exciting cultural experience. Just a short boat ride away, Kos offers a different atmosphere filled with rich history and vibrant life. The stunning coastline and charming architecture invite exploration.

Upon arrival, you can visit historical sites like the ancient ruins of Asklepios. The island’s history is fascinating, as it was once a center for healing in the ancient world. Wandering through the old town, you’ll find quaint shops and cafes offering delicious Greek cuisine.

Sampling local dishes, including gyros and fresh seafood, is a highlight of visiting Kos. Experience the vibrant culinary scene that blends local flavors with Mediterranean influence.

The island is also known for its beautiful beaches. Take a relaxing swim or sunbathe under the warm sun before heading back to Didim.

A day trip to Kos immerses you in the rich culture and history of Greece while creating unforgettable memories during your time in the region.
